I'm having trouble with a 2-stage rocket. When launching, it either doesn't start or when it launches properly the second stages engine won't start after the first stage is jettisoned. Also, when adding boosters on the side of the rocket, the spaceship won't fly upwards but turns and crashes immediately (which actually looks pretty spectacular). Any ideas what I did wrong?

You've got your staging reversed. Higher numbered stages go first. Stage 0 is the final one.

As soon as you launch it triggers stage 3. Take a look at what's inside stage 3: a decoupler and guess what, a parachute.

You have the staging backwards. The bottom stage is what's going to to fire first when you're on the launch pad.

Also, you can combine the decoupler and the engine above it into one stage. So when you hit the spacebar, it will decouple the lower stage and activate the next engine at the same time.

Also, SRB engines do not "gimbal," or pivot their thrust to assist with steering. I suspect that when you add those side boosters, the ship simply becomes too big for the torque of the pod to hold on course. Either add some fins with control surfaces, or replace the engines with the kinds that have "thrust vectoring" in their part descriptions. Oh, and an ASAS control piece to give instructions to the fins/engines.
